摘要:
A spinal cord hemisection injury model was established in rats. Treatment with IN-1 and/or neuro-trophin-3 was found to regulate the expression of growth-associated protein 43, nerve growth factor, and basic fibroblast growth factor genes in the injured spinal cord tissues; transcript levels were first increased and then decreased. Expression levels reached a peak at days 7 (growth-associated protein 43) or 14 (nerve growth factor and basic fibroblast growth factor) following spinal cord injury. Combined treatment with neurotrophin-3 and IN-1 achieved the most apparent effect on the ex-pression and recovery of motor function. These findings confirm that combined therapy with neuro-trophin-3 and IN-1 can increase expression of growth factors in the injured spinal cord tissues and promote the axonal regeneration.
